Minecraft by Betafreak is a game inspired by the famous Minecraft, as written by Markus "Notch" Peterson. This release is Alpha v 0.0.6, which adds a 24-space inventory accessible with Mode, as well as several speed optimizations and variable mining (Stone yields Cobblestone when mined, for instance). Please see "readme.txt" and "changelog.txt" for more information, as well as "instructions for developers.txt" if you are interested in helping with the project.

This is version 2.0.4 of the TIFC. The previous version only supported roughly 68 conversions, took 4 programs and a picture variable, and was around 6kb in size. Version 2.0.X supports the usage of a single program, and boasts 708 conversions available in this single program of just over 7kb in size. It is also available for the TI-73, TI-82, TI-83, TI-83+/84+ and TI-84+CSE, with the potential of being programmed on other calculators at a later date.

A utility for packing binaries into Prizm addon (.g3a) files, with name localization and icon support. Also includes tools for manipulating icons in g3a files: g3a-updateicon allows you to change the icons in a g3a file without otherwise modifying it.
This package includes source code (buildable on most operating systems with CMake) and precompiled Windows binaries (.exe) of mkg3a and g3a-updateicon.

Update: This is the original SYNDIV, with 1916 bytes. The previous version with 1840 bytes was buggy. I am including it in the file since you are still downloading it, trying to figure out which version is best. Well, here they are, both of them. As you will see, SYNDIV1 is the better one, faster and with fewer bytes, and with the ability to enter the terms in any order.
Making a port from TI-Basic to Casio-basic, was a bad idea. Trying to think in TI’s basic and then put it on a Casio does not make Casio justice, as you can see in the previous versions. So, I’ve made a new program from scratch, on my Casio fx CG50. The number of bytes have dropped from 1916 to 1196, and the program is much faster now. As in previous versions, you can only use x as variable, and only integer coefficients, but you can enter the terms in any order, and there can be more than one of the same degree. The lists however, are still presented one by one vertically, and the only limits for the number of polynomials you can enter, is memory and the degree of the first polynomial.

This is updated version of the wave player.
Changes:
- COM speed increased 4x (to 460800), so it is 1/4 of COM speed used by fxPlayer. This means sound quality is better, but do not expect miracles. I was able to directly access the sio registers (thank you Simon :-) ), but it seems the serial port is less powerful compared to the one in 9860G (one speed register is missing and fifo is only 16 B).
- player remained synchronous, but it is able to play the whole wav - it creates the map of the file in flash and while playing it reads the file from flash directly (see source for details)I am not sure I will be able to increase the sound quality, I thing I touch the HW limits

Buttonz v1.8 is a flash app and ASM program for the TI-84 Plus C Silver Edition calculator. Send Buttonz.8ck to your calculator using TI Connect and run it by pressing [APPS] and selecting Buttonz. You can also sent Buttonz.8xp to your calculator and run it with Doors CSE 8 or higher. Match the blocks to the color of the arrows. The closer the block is to the center of the arrows the more points you will get. If its pretty close to the center, your bonus will go up and you will receive up to 5 times the points. Your bonus will decrement if the block is not centered. If there is no block present, your bonus will go straight to 1 and you will lose 10 points. If a block goes down through the bottom of the screen or if you match the wrong color, you lose a life. You have three lives to get as many points as you can. Use the left and right buttons to shift the color of the arrows. Press F1-F5 to select the blocks. Press the 2nd key to increase the level up to level 10. Pressing On at any time will exit the app.

Gossamer 1.0 is a web browser for TI-83+ through TI-84+SE graphing calculators, using Doors CS 7, CALCnet 2.2, and globalCALCnet to download and display web pages from the internet. Scroll by lines or pages, click links, and browse to arbitrary URLs. Gossamer requires Doors CS 7.2 Beta 2 or higher (see http://dcs.cemetech.net) and can be used with an Arduino-based gCn bridge or a mini-USB cable. More info at http://cemete.ch/pr37.

Amazonka's Lock add-in is minimalistic and very Casio OS looking interface to power off and subsequently unlock your Prizm/Casio FX-CG. It locks the calculator using Casio's built-in User Name password as registered under System manager from MAIN MENU. Even if User Name setup is deleted, the latest available password (if ever registered) will still work. This also means no additional setup or files in main or storage memory are needed to store your password, i.e. resetting main and storage memories without wiping add-ins will not effect the lock functionality. Even deleting User password won't effect the add-in: only user name and org will show in red then.

globalCALCnet or gCn allows calculators to network from two feet, two miles, or two thousand miles away. gCn consists of a client program that must be run on a computer, as well as a way to connect your calculator(s) and computers. This can be a mini-USB cable for a TI-84+ or TI-84+SE calculator. It can also be firmware loaded onto an Arduino or custom AVR to bridge between a CALCnet2.2 network and the computer running the gCnClient software. The gCnClient program provided in this zip is built for Windows, Mac OS, Linux, and Raspberry Pi; the gCnBridge firmware images for the Arduino and USBID bridge designs are also included. A detailed PDF describes the installation and use of the required software, as well as plans and schematics for constructing the variations on the bridge. v2.0 adds full support for the direct USB (mini-USB) method of connecting TI-84+/SE calculators to gCn, as well as bug and stability fixes.
